Abstract
⺠In this study, the effect of Aniline and SDS surfactant on mean drop size was investigated in a mixer-settler. ⺠For this purpose, the effects of impeller speed and hold-up on the mean drop size were examined with and without surfactant. ⺠The results revealed that D32, in Aniline system is larger than D32 in SDS system. ⺠The system with Aniline surfactant has a better agreement with Hinze-Kolmogorov's theory.
